Located in the magnificent Mas Trempat urbanization in Sant Feliu de Guíxols on the Costa Brava, this modern villa embodies Mediterranean elegance and architectural innovation. With a total surface area of 314 m² spread over three levels (basement, first floor and second floor) and a 449 m² plot, this house is a model of sustainable design and timeless elegance.

A privileged location

Just a five-minute drive from the beaches of Sant Feliu de Guíxols and S'Agaró, this four-wind house enjoys optimal exposure. The prominent south-west façade captures natural light, making every space bright and welcoming.

A composition of Mediterranean materials

For this project, the architects opted for natural-looking materials, creating a harmony between modernity and tradition. WEO cladding is combined with elements such as natural stone, white mortar plaster, lime and clay, reminiscent of the typical characteristics of Mediterranean buildings.
